Output ec953a197d6695c50f3a8f4c6385646ebf8703363ce96c406432664b9308ec0e:0

value
33831608
script pubkey
OP_0 OP_PUSHBYTES_20 7962a196b5cb61b872bae7c7b820584c4719d1fb
address
bc1q0932r944edsmsu46ulrmsgzcf3r3n50ml4wcg2
transaction
ec953a197d6695c50f3a8f4c6385646ebf8703363ce96c406432664b9308ec0e
confirmations
188404
spent
true